Gazing upon this unassuming structure, could you ever guess its vibrant history? This, my friends, is the Koiwa Catholic Church, a beacon of faith nestled in the heart of Tokyo. Koiwa Catholic Church may seem modest from the outside, but its story is one of resilience and growth. It began in 1954 as a small sub-parish of Honjo Church with a mere 30 members. Imagine those early days, a handful of believers gathering in a city not traditionally known for Christianity. The present chapel, a testament to international collaboration, was completed in 1958 thanks to generous support from the Cologne Archdiocese in Germany. Koiwa Catholic Church is dedicated to St. Boniface, a figure whose life is as fascinating as the church itself. Known as the Apostle of Germany, St. Boniface played a pivotal role in converting Germanic tribes to Christianity, organizing churches, and strengthening ties between the Holy See and Frankish Churches. The church’s symbolic mark, an oak tree and an ax, reflects a dramatic moment in St. Boniface’s life. He felled an oak tree revered by pagans as the dwelling of Thor, the thunder god. When divine retribution failed to strike him down, many were converted and baptized. Koiwa Catholic Church continued to flourish, celebrating its 50th anniversary in 2008. In a remarkable event in 2009, relics of St. Boniface, a gift from the Cologne Archdiocese, were enshrined within the chapel. Located in the lively Nishikoiwa district of Edogawa Ward, the church radiates a warm, family-like atmosphere. The nearby Edo River flows gently towards Tokyo Bay, adding a touch of serenity to this bustling urban setting. Not far from famous spots like the Shibamata Taishakuten Temple, featured in the beloved “Torasan” film series, Koiwa Catholic Church offers a spiritual haven in the heart of Tokyo.
